i went a while without sex and recently had sex and starting the day after i have been having alot of clear liquid coming out. and i had sex again and it came out soo much that i had to stop with in one minute of it because it was running down my backside alot? is it possible i may be pregnant.
According to your history the possible causes of the discharge are: - Physiological leucorrhea, during intercourse due to the secretion of the bartholin glands physiological leucorrhea can be seen - Sometimes seminal fluid can come out of the vagina after intercourse. - Pelvic infection
If you had unprotected intercourse around the time of your ovulation, the possibility for pregnancy cannot be excluded. Using a vaginal wash with pH 3.5 to 4.5 can help in decreasing the physiological leucorrhea and related symptoms. If problem still persist, you may need to get examined once. In case of pelvic infection local and systemic antibiotics can help.
